Project Portfolio Highlights Eden Project Morecambe – a new cultural and visitor offer for Morecambe, Lancaster, that will support regeneration and economic diversification in the town centre and coastal area. The project is backed by significant government funding and aims to open in 2026. South East Warrington Urban Extension – a 4,000+ home new urban extension to the south east of the town of Warrington. Heathlands Garden Community – leadership of the Social Value Workstream and Equality Impact Assessment for a new settlement of 5,000 new homes, 16 ha of employment, a district centre and two local centres, and supporting infrastructure around a new railway station on the Ashford‑Maidstone line, in Kent. A29, Cookstown, Northern Ireland – leading a Social Value engagement exercise on behalf of the Department for Infrastructure, to hear from the community about their desired social value opportunities and priorities that the construction phase could deliver. Your day‑to‑day will include … Developing socio‑economic strategies and evidence to support planning and investment decisions, including alignment with local and national policy frameworks. Undertaking Economic Impact Modelling to assess the economic potential of sites, including employment, skills, population and demographic indicators. Drafting Socio‑Economic Statements and Impact Assessments to support development proposals, regeneration schemes, and infrastructure projects. Leading socio‑economic inputs within multidisciplinary teams, contributing to integrated planning, transport, and sustainability strategies. Attending stakeholder, design team, and client meetings to inform analysis and reporting. Managing project delivery, including scope, programme, and budgetary control across multiple commissions. Collaborating with colleagues across WSP, such as those in Planning, Urban Design, Transport and Sustainability to ensure socio‑economic considerations are embedded in wider project advice.
